13598850747

全国统一学习专线 9:00-21:00
19号学苑> 学校首页> 学习资料> 想成为鸿蒙应用开发工程师需要掌握哪些技能?IT技能培训

想成为鸿蒙应用开发工程师需要掌握哪些技能?IT技能培训

发表于:2025-07-07 15:30:50 391 浏览

想成为鸿蒙应用开发工程师,可不是简单学学编程就能实现的。首先得掌握 HarmonyOS 应用开发的基础,比如熟悉 ArkTS、Java 等开发语言,ArkTS 是鸿蒙开发的主推语言,语法简洁,上手后能快速搭建应用框架;Java 则在兼容性和生态上有优势。还要了解鸿蒙系统的分布式特性,明白如何实现多设备间的数据流转和协同操作,像手机、平板、智能手表等设备的互联互通开发。想学习鸿蒙应用开发,建议看看我们IT技能培训机构的课程!

IT技能培训机构,学IT技能,IT就业方向,编程语言学习

熟悉鸿蒙系统的基础知识

要了解鸿蒙系统的架构,知道它是怎么分层的,像内核层、系统服务层、框架层和应用层各自都有什么作用,这样才能清楚应用在整个系统中处于什么位置,以及如何与系统的其他部分协同工作。

还要熟悉鸿蒙系统的各种特性,特别是分布式这一核心特性,明白怎么利用它来实现跨设备的功能,比如让手机上的应用数据能快速同步到平板上之类的。

同时对于鸿蒙提供的各类 API 也要了如指掌,不管是用于 UI 开发的,还是数据存储、网络通信等方面的,这些 API 就像是搭建应用的积木,掌握好了才能拼出各种功能强大的应用。

编程语言方面也很关键

ArkTS 是鸿蒙应用开发中比较重要的语言,需要熟练掌握它的语法,比如装饰器语法怎么用,还有状态管理相关的知识,像@State这种状态修饰符的用法等,这样才能更好地实现应用的交互逻辑和数据更新。

另外对于异步编程等内容也要熟悉,因为在处理网络请求等场景时会经常用到。

除了 ArkTS,Java 语言也不能忽视,虽然现在 ArkTS 越来越常用,但 Java 在鸿蒙开发中也有一定的应用场景,它的面向对象编程思想、多线程等知识,对于开发复杂的应用逻辑很有帮助。

开发工具的使用也必须熟练

DevEco Studio 是官方主推的开发工具,要把它用得得心应手才行。得知道怎么用它来创建项目,如何进行代码的编写、调试,还要会用里面的性能分析工具,比如看看应用有没有内存泄漏的问题等。而且,要熟悉它的多端实时预览功能,这样在设计 UI 界面的时候,就能及时看到效果并进行调整。

同时对于 OpenHarmony SDK 也要了解,学会配置开发环境,这样才能更好地进行开发工作,如果涉及到设备驱动等开发,这部分知识就更重要了。

其他方面

关于 UI 设计,就要掌握 ArkUI 框架。要清楚各种布局组件,像 Flex、Grid 等怎么用,才能把界面元素合理地摆放好,让界面看起来美观又实用。还要了解动画效果的实现方法,以及如何处理用户的操作事件,比如点击按钮、滑动屏幕等,让应用能给用户带来好的交互体验。

此外分布式架构相关的知识也不能少。要深入理解分布式软总线的原理,知道它是怎么实现设备之间的连接和通信的。对于分布式数据管理也要掌握,比如如何使用DistributedData来实现数据在不同设备间的同步和共享。还要明白任务调度机制,这样才能开发出像多设备任务流转这样的功能,提升应用的全场景使用体验。

性能优化方面的知识也很重要。要懂得如何进行内存管理,避免应用出现内存占用过高或者泄漏的情况,导致应用卡顿甚至崩溃。对于渲染优化也要有一定的了解,让界面的显示更加流畅。

留言

体验课开班倒计时

11: 59: 59

稍后会有老师给您回电,请保持电话畅通

电话:13598850747
刘老师 QQ:1017512865